Effect of Route of Trihalomethanes (THM) Administration on Renal Toxicity in Male Rat

  • Single non-lethal doses of chloroform $(CHCL_3)$ dichlorobromomethane $(CHCL_2Br)$, dibromochloromethane $(CHCIBr_2)$, or bromoform $(CHBr_3)$ were administered to male rats. Routes of exposure including single intraperitional (ip) and subcutaneous (sc) injection were used in order to permit comparison of severity of THM effects and renal toxicity was assessed at varied times following treatment. On an equimolar basis, sc administration of $CHBr_3$ (either 12 or 3 mmoles/kg) is more effective at increasing KW/BW than ip $CHCI_3$ treatment. Plasma urea nitrogen (BUN) following ip THM injections are markedly increased with all four THM at 24 hours post treatment. BUN response to $CHCL_2Br$ and $CHCIBr_3$-effected BUN levels have essentially returned to those of vehicle control. THM sc treatment results in a BUN response similar to that seen following ip treatment, with only the time course being different. With the exception of $CHCL_3$, sc and ip-treatments appear to be equally effective in evoking absolute BUN elevations. These results suggest that THM administration induce renal toxicity dependent upon the route or exposure.

Effects of Panax Ginseng on the Development of Morphine Induced Tolerance and Dependence (II) -Effects of Ginseng Butanol Fraction on the Development of Morphine Induced Tolerance and Dopamine Receptor Supersensitivity in Rats- (Morphine의 내성(耐性) 및 의존성(依存性) 형성(形成)에 미치는 인삼(人蔘)의 효과(II) -인삼(人蔘)의 Butanol 분획이 흰쥐의 Morphine 내성(耐性) 및 Dopamine 수용체(受容體) 초과민성(超過敏性) 형성에 미치는 영향(影響)-)

  • Intraperitoneal administration of ginseng butanol fraction(GBF) to chronic morphinization in male Sprague-Dawley rats inhibited the development of tolerance to the analgesic effect and hyperthermic action of morphine. Rats were rendered tolerant to morphine by subcutaneous multiple morphine injections for a period of 8 days. The development of tolerance was evidenced by the decreased analgesic response to morphine and inhibition of tolerance by the greater analgesic response. Concomitant administration of morphine with GBF blocked the tolerance to the hyperthermic effect of morphine as evidenced by elevation of body temperature by morphine. Dopamine receptor sensitivity was enhanced in morphine tolerant rats as measured by apomorphine induced in spontaneous motor activity. GBF administration also blocked dopamine receptor supersensitivity induced by chronic morphinization.

Fixation of Epidural Catheters using blood Set -Report of 120 cases- (지속성 경막외카테터의 거치 방법 -수혈선을 이용하여-)

  • Secure fixation is essential for continous epidural catheterization on a long-term-basis. Adhesive tape or surgical knots were commonly used for those patients, but the surgical knot method has a tendency to cause strangulation of catheter. Another invasive technique, subcutaneous tissue tunnelling is more safe than other methods but requires sophisticated technique and time. We employed a simple device using a blood transfusion set for patients who have epidural catheters placed safely un their backs. In 120 patients treated for postoperative and chronic pain by means of this technique, the results were as follows: 1) Five of 120 patients (4.2%) developed backache and pruritus, but there were no instances of respiratory depression, local infection and headache. 2) Nine of 120 patients (7.5%) failed booster-injections, but two cases were due to be non-technical errors. 3) The duration of fixation was 1~3 days in most cases (85%), the longest being for 21 days.

Ameliorative Effect of Yacon Containing Herbal Mixture against Benign Prostatic Hyperplasia Symptoms (야콘을 포함한 수종 천연물 처방의 전립선비대 증상 개선효과)

  • We evaluated the benign prostatic hyperplasia (BPH) with Yacon pill, the preparation composed of Smallanthus sonchifolius, Torilis japonica and Acorus gramineus. A total of 45 rats were divided into five groups. One group was used as a control and the other groups received subcutaneous injections of testosterone for 4 weeks to induce BPH. Yacon pill extract (200 or 400 mg/kg) was administered daily for 4 weeks to two groups by oral gavage concurrently with testosterone. The rats euthanized, the prostate and body weights were recorded, and tissues were subjected to hormone assay. In addition, we investigated proliferating cell nuclear antigen (PCNA) expression in the prostate using immunoblotting. Rats with BPH showed significantly increased prostate weights, increased dihydrotestosterone (DHT) levels in the serum and increased PCNA expression in the prostate; however, Yacon pill extracts treated rats showed significant reduction of prostate weights, DHT levels and PCNA expression compared with the BPH group. Conclusively, Yacon pill showed the possibility as ameliorable agents of BPH symptoms.

Bilateral symmetrical lipoma of the buccal fat pad as an incidental finding in a woman with weight gain after tamoxifen: a case report

  • Although lipoma is a common benign tumor, it occurs relatively infrequently in the oral and maxillofacial areas, and only 31 cases of lipoma in the buccal fat pad have been reported. Herein, we present an extremely rare case of symmetric lipomas in both buccal fat pads. These masses were incidentally discovered during a facelift procedure in a 50-year-old woman with a 4-year history of tamoxifen use. during which she had gained 10 kg. The patient stated that cheek protrusion had developed concomitantly with weight gain and was exacerbated by an injection lipolysis procedure she had received 1 year previously. This case underscores the importance of paying careful attention to the patient's medication use and surgical history when evaluating suspected cases of lipoma, and sheds light on tamoxifen use and subcutaneous injections of phosphatidylcholine and deoxycholate as potential risk factors for lipoma development.

Distribution of the Mast Cells in the Parenchymal Organs of the Cattle, Horses, Pigs, Dogs, and Rompun-induced Mast Cell Degranulation in the Dog (우(牛), 마(馬), 돈(豚) 및 견(犬)의 실질장기내(實質臟器內) Mast Cell 분포(分布)와 Rompun을 투여(投與)한 견(犬)의 Mast Cell 탈과립소견(脫顆粒所見))

  • This paper dealt with the distribution of normal mast cells in the spleen, liver and lung on cattle, horses, pigs and dogs, and also degranulation of mast cells in the dogs infected with Rompun (2% Xylazine HCl). The results observed are summarized as follows. Normal mast cells were distributed in spleen, liver and lung on cattle, horse, pig and dog. Mast cells were observed in both red pulp and surroundings of white pulp of the spleen in horse, in the white pulp of the spleen in cattle, in the trabeculae of the spleen in pigs, and in white pulp and red pulp of the spleen in dogs, respectively. Mast cells were observed in the portal triad of the liver in cattle and horses, in both portal triad and interlobular connective tissues of the liver in pigs, and not only the portal triad but also walls of the sinusoids and the central veins in dogs. A large number of mast cells were observed in the interlobular septa and peribronchioles of lung on all the species in this experiment. The mast cells are more numerous in the lungs than other organs. Author considers that numbers of normal mast cells distributed in the tissue is related to the dosage of Rompun in animal. The degranulation of mast cells were observed in the subcutaneous tissues of dog intramuscularly injected with Rompun(0.5ml/times) for 4 or 5 times and subcutaneously injected with Rompun(0.3ml/times) for 4 times. In dog intradermally injected with 0.1ml of Rompun, mast cells were decreased in number at 30 minutes and markedly decreased in number at 2 hours, but more or less increased in number at 3 hours after injection. In addition, the granules of the mast cells were decreased in number at 30 minutes and marked degranulation of the mast cells were recognized at 2 hours after injections, but normal mast cells begun to appear in subcutaneous tissue with the lapse of time from 3 hours after injection. There was also observed local infiltration of neutrophils in subcutaneous tissues of dogs intradermally injected with 0.1ml of Rompun at 30 minutes. At 2 hours after injection, numerous neutrophils and a small number of eosinophils were observed in the site of injection. Conclusionally, Rompun was regarded as a factor which causes the degranulateon of mast cell and the authors considered that histamine released from the mast cells by Rompun might cause relaxation of skeletal muscle.

Development of Polyclonal Antibodies to Abdominal and Subcutaneous Adipocyte for Producing Fat-reduced High Quality Pork (저지방 고품질 돈육 생산을 위한 돼지 복강 및 피하지방 항체 개발)

  • The aim of the present study was to develop polyclonal antibodies to regional inedible adipocytes of pigs and investigate the effect of these antibodies on adipocytes in vitro. As antigens, abdominal and subcutaneous adipocyte PMPs from pigs were injected into sheep 3 times per 3 wk intervals for passive immunization, and non-immunized serum, antisera against abodominal (AAb) or subcutaneous adipocyte PMPs (SAb) were collected before and after the injections. Titers of the antisera obtained from sheep and their cross-reactivities with the heart, kidney, liver, lung, muscle, and spleen of pig were determined by ELISA. Isolation and culture of abdominal and subcutaneous adipocytes from pigs were performed to analyze LDH concentration. At a 1:1,000 dilution, little antibody reactivity was observed for non-immunized serum whereas both AAb and SAb had relatively strong reactivity up to a dilution of 1:16,000. These findings may indicate that strong antibodies against adipocyte PMPs can be developed using an immunological approach. Extremely low reactivity of AAb and SAb was detected with the PMPs of the organs. Both antisera most strongly reacted with each adipocyte PMPs and showed statistically (p<0.05) higher cross-reactivities compared with the non-immunized serum. In conclusion, these results may indicate that the present polyclonal antibodies against regional inedible adipocyte PMPs are well developed and are safe against cross-reactivities with the organs of pigs. Further studies on the in vivo nutritional safety and fat reduction of these antibodies in pigs will be required fat-reduced high quality pork production.

Effects of Exposure Period on the Developmental Toxicity of 2-Bromopropane in Sprague-Dawley Rats

  • Recently we reported that 2-bromopropane (2-BP) has maternal toxicity, embryotoxicity, and teratogenicity in Sprague-Dawley rats. The aims of this study are to examine the potential effects of 2-BP administration on pregnant dams and embryo-fetal development, and to investigate the effects of metabolic activation induced by phenobarbital (PB) on developmental toxicities of 2-BP. Pregnant rats received 1000 mg/kg/day subcutaneous 2-BP injections on gestational days (GD) 6 through 10 (Group II and Group IIII) or 11 through 15 (Group IV). Pregnant rats in Group III received an intraperitoneal PB injection once daily at 80 mg/kg/day on GD 3 through 5 for induction of the liver metabolic enzyme system. Control rats received vehicle injections only on GD 6 through 15. All dams underwent caesarean sections on GD 20 and their fetuses were examined for external, visceral, and skeletal abnormalities. Significant adverse effects on pregnant dams and embryo-fetal development were observed in all the treatment groups, and the maternal and embryo-fetal effects of 2-BP observed in Group II were higher than those seen in Group IV. Conversely, maternal and embryo-fetal developmental toxicities observed in Group III were comparable to those seen in Group II. These results suggest that the potential effects of 2-BP on pregnant dams and embryo-fetal development are more likely in the first half of organogenesis (days $6{\sim}10$ of pregnancy) than in the second half and that the metabolic activation induced by PB pre-treatment did not modify the developmental toxic effects of 2-BP in rats.

Comparison of follitropin ${\beta}$ administered by a pen device with follitropin ${\beta}$ administered by a conventional syringe in patients undergoing IVF-ET

  • Objective: To compare the effectiveness and convenience of a pen device for the self-administration of follitropin ${\beta}$ with a conventional syringe delivering follitropin ${\beta}$ solution in patients undergoing IVF-ET. Methods: GnRH agonist long protocol was used for controlled ovarian stimulation (COS) in all subjects. A total of 100 patients were randomized into the pen device group or the conventional syringe group on the first day of COS. Local tolerance reactions were assessed within 5 minutes, at 1 hour and at 3 hours after each injection. On the day of hCG injection, patients were asked to rate their overall pain and convenience experienced with self-injection on a visual anlaogue scale (VAS). Results: There were no differences in patients' characteristics between the two groups. The duration of COS was significantly shorter in the pen device group than in the conventional syringe group. Patients included in the pen device group needed a significantly smaller amount of follitropin ${\beta}$. However, no differences between the two groups were found in IVF results and pregnancy outcome. The incidence of local pain within 5 minutes, at 1 hour and at 3 hours after the injection was significantly lower in the pen device group. VAS scores indicated that injections using the pen device were significantly less painful and more convenient. Conclusion: The pen device for self-administration of follitropin ${\beta}$ is less painful, safer and more convenient for the patients, and can be more effective because of the shorter duration and smaller dose of follitropin ${\beta}$ when compared with the conventional syringe.

Subcutaneous Administration of Highly Purified-FSH(HP-FSH) versus Intramuscular Administration of FSH in Superovulation for IVF-ET (체외수정시술을 위한 과배란유도시 Highly Purified Follicle Stimulating Hormone (HP-FSH) 피하주사와 Follicle Stimulating Hormone 근육주사의 비교연구)

  • The early studies demonstrated that the relative amount of FSH was important for stimulating normal ovarian activity and demonstrated the existence of a threshold level for FSH, above which follicular growth was activated. It was found that only a modest increase in circulating FSH level above the threshold (between 10 and 30%) was required to stimulate folliculogenesis. In addition, FSH is primary responsible for initiating estradiol production through the activation of the aromatase enzyme system in granulosa cells, follicular secretion and growth. LH on the other hand, plays a supportive role in ovarian steroidogenesis, stimulating the ovarian thecal cells to produce androgen, the precursor for estradiol synthesis. But there is now an increasing number of reports in the literature demonstrating an adverse effect of LH on fertility and miscarriage in infertile and fertile women. So HP-FSH is the drug of a highly purified FSH preparation which has a higher specific activity and far fewer impurities than FSH. This study was performed to evaluate the efficacy and safety of HP-FSH administered (SC; subcutaneous) versus FSH(IM; intramuscular) for ovulation induction. 20 candidates patients for ovulation induction were participated. All patients underwent pituitary desensitizing with a long gonadotropin-releasing hormone (GnRH) agonist protocol and ovulation induction was started with HP-FSH SC (10 patients; group I) or FSH IM (10 patients; group II). After ovulation, outcome of ovulation induction and local reaction of injection site were compared. There were no difference of outcome of ovulation in two groups except pregnancy rate/embryo transfer. Group I had a higher pregnancy rate/ embryo transfer than Group II (44.4% Vs 28.6%). Pain, redness, tenderness, bruising and itching when the injection received on the first 5 days of treated (50 SC and 50 IM injections) were assessed. There were no significant difference (P>0.05) in the incidence of tenderness, bruising and itching between the IM and SC injection. But IM injection (FSH) had a tendency of higher above incidence. The number of reports of pain, redness were significantly increased in IM injection group (P<0.05). These results indicate that SC administration of HP-FSH has been shown to be as effect for superovulation as traditional gonadotropins, with an improved safety profile due to the removal of extaneous proteins.
